School District Details

Faculty Details and Student Enrollment

Students and Faculty
  • Total Students Enrolled: 373
  • Total Full Time "Equivalent" Teachers: 28.4
  • Average Student-To-Teacher Ratio: 13.1
Students Gender Breakdown
  • Males: 196 (52.5%)
  • Females: 177 (47.5%)
Free Lunch Student Eligibility Breakdown
  • Eligible for Reduced Lunch: 47 (12.6%)
  • Eligible for Free Lunch: 212 (56.8%)
  • Eligible for Either Reduced or Free Lunch: 259 (69.4%)
